Hey this is my first corn, it's a normal corn. I got him on Tuesday. I fed him Wednesday night. He ate the food immediately. Wasn't too big or anything. Now he hasn't moved from his spot under the clay pot since about yesterday this time. I'm just wondering if this is normal. While I'm at it, I'll tell you what I have as a setup so far.
Have a water dish, but it's off the ground, not sure if he knows its there. I'm using a 20 gallon tank and for light there is a 75 watt exoterra heat bulb that I have pointing into the tank. The tank is usually around 78-83F, at least that's what the sticker says. I have some kind of store bought bark for the flooring. I was wondering if maybe he isn't seeing the water, or maybe is sick from the food, because he was very active when we first got him, even before feeding yesterday, anytime there was motion on the lid of the tank, he was dart around, now when I shake the potter he's hiding upder, he barely moves...

Have a read of the f a q's and you'll see that the snake is resting while it digests it's meal. This is perfectly normal, and making it move around by disturbing it could provoke a regurge.
Sticker-type thermometers are not accurate enough, you'd be better with a digital thermometer so you can measure your temps.

If you want to make sure your corn has found his water bowl which i recommend putting at ground level (not sure what you meant by this) then put the bowl somewhere around the edge of your vivarium. The edges of the viv will be where your snake is most likely to explore first.
